Entrance gates, built c.1830, formerly leading to Clifton House, house now in use as a convalescent home. Ashlar limestone curved entrance walls with chamfered coping stones, surmounted by decorative cast-iron railings, with spear finials to east section. Square-profile ashlar limestone piers with recessed panels, plinths and flat caps having double-leaf decorative cast-iron gates. Three-bay single-storey gate lodge to east.
This handsome entrance forms an interesting and notable feature in the streetscape. Its curved walls and symmetrical form lend an air of elegance, which is enhanced by well-crafted materials such as the ashlar walls and piers. The decorative gates add artistic interest.
